#730c40 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#730c40 is composed of 45.1% red, 4.7%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 89.6% magenta, 44.3%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 329.7 degrees, a saturation of 81.1% and a lightness of 24.9%. #730c40 color hex could be obtained by blending #e61880 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

Shades and Tints of #730c40

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080105 is the darkest color, while #fef6f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#730c40

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#423d40 is the less saturated color, while #7d0240 is the most saturated one.
